The History of Sauk County, Wisconsin Publisher: Western Historical Co. (Chicago), 1880 DENNIS CLOSLEY, farmer, Sec. 23; P.O. Reedsburg; son of Thomas and Susan (Kelley) Closey; was born in Country Kilkenny, Ireland, in 1813; came to the United States the year of the great fire in New York City (1835); remained there about eleven years. He was married at Hudson, July 22, 1842, to Mary, daughter of Felix and Catherine (McGregor) Donley; she was born in the County of Antrim, Ireland; Mr. C. and family came to Wisconsin in 1845, settled in the town of Lima, Rock Co., and in October, 1850, came to Sauk Co., stopping a short time in the village of Reedsburg; he bought 160 acres in Sec. 23, Town 12, Range 3, now Ironton; here the walls of a log house were erected, and Dec. 15 the family moved, without roads or bridges to their new habitation; as they depended on the lumber which formed the shanty at Reedsburg to complete the house, they found themselves in the cold rain-storm in a house without roof or floor; one corner was covered with loose boards; here the family took shelter till the lumber could be brought to finish the house; their nearest neighbor was G. W. Gary, living three and a half miles to the south, and the next one was Mr. S. Baker, living four miles east; the first white person whom they saw was Mr. Gary, in the April of the next year. Mr. and Mrs. C. have seven children - Edward, married to Isabella Pine, living in Minnesota; John, married to Margaret Sammon, living on the same section as his father; Thomas, married to Margaret Welch; also living on the same section; William J., living at home; Felix D., living in Allegany Co., N.Y.; Catherine and Joseph, living in Chicago. Mr. Closey has been Clerk of his school district ten years.
